We don't have to check for -fno-optimize-sibling-calls since even
gcc 3.2 supports it.

Signed-off-by: Adrian Bunk <[EMAIL PROTECTED]>

---
--- linux-2.6.22-rc6-mm1/Makefile.old   2007-07-13 06:01:20.000000000 +0200
+++ linux-2.6.22-rc6-mm1/Makefile       2007-07-13 06:01:44.000000000 +0200
@@ -493,7 +493,7 @@
 include $(srctree)/arch/$(ARCH)/Makefile
 
 ifdef CONFIG_FRAME_POINTER
-CFLAGS         += -fno-omit-frame-pointer $(call 
cc-option,-fno-optimize-sibling-calls,)
+CFLAGS         += -fno-omit-frame-pointer -fno-optimize-sibling-calls
 else
 CFLAGS         += -fomit-frame-pointer
 endif
